Output 3598751d721db9784d3eb8fcec99d6fb665f651202a3e08faae06dcba2a6406e:0

value
492965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9edff9e07655f9cd57359a798dd2cbcfc88850f6 OP_EQUAL
address
3GB4zz28BfQJgmVxi9jsQpYeN9qKaNL4V2
transaction
3598751d721db9784d3eb8fcec99d6fb665f651202a3e08faae06dcba2a6406e
confirmations
366638
spent
true